Cable Bent Over Chest Press Single Arm

The Bent-Over Single-Arm Cable Chest Press targets the chest while engaging the core for stability due to the angled body position and unilateral resistance.

How to

How to do the Cable Bent Over Chest Press Single Arm

  1. 01

    Set a cable handle to chest height.

  2. 02

    Stand facing away from the machine and hinge slightly forward at the hips.

  3. 03

    Grip the handle with one hand and position it near your chest.

  4. 04

    Brace your core and press the handle forward until your arm is fully extended.

  5. 05

    Squeeze your chest at the end of the movement.

  6. 06

    Slowly return the handle back to the starting position and repeat before switching sides.

Performance tips

Cues that matter

  • Keep your torso stable and avoid twisting
  • Maintain a slight forward lean throughout
  • Control the return phase to stay under tension
